CVE-2014-7951

28
FAUCET Score

CVE-2014-7951 is a directory traversal vulnerability affecting the Android debug bridge (adb) in Android 4.0.4. This flaw allows a physically proximate attacker with a direct connection to the device to write to arbitrary system-owned files by manipulating tar archive headers with ".." sequences. The vulnerability has a CVSS score of 4.6 (Medium), indicating a low attack complexity and no user interaction required, but it necessitates physical access to the device. While not actively exploited in the wild, an ExploitDB entry (EDB-36813) exists, and there is no significant community discussion or media coverage surrounding this CVE.
